Description:ABHD14B (abhydrolase domain containing 14B) belongs to the AB hydrolase superfamily. This protein contains an alpha/beta hydrolase fold, which is a catalytic domain found in a very wide range of enzymes. In molecular biology, the alpha/beta hydrolase fold is common to a number of hydrolytic enzymes of widely differing phylogenetic origin and catalytic function. The Ab hydrolase domain containing (ABHD) gene subfamily is comprised of 15 mostly uncharacterized members. ABHD14B has hydrolase activity towards p-nitrophenyl butyrate (in vitro). It may activate transcription. Recombinant human ABHD14B protein, fused to His-tag at N-terminus, was expressed in E. coli and purified by using conventional chromatography techniques.
